Description

4-o-Deacetylvinblastine-3-Oic Acid is a key vinca alkaloid derivative and an important pharmaceutical intermediate. This compound is valued for its role in the synthesis and research of complex bioactive molecules, particularly in oncology. It is primarily required by pharmaceutical R&D laboratories, fine chemical manufacturers, and academic institutions engaged in anticancer drug development and natural product chemistry.

Application

  • Pharmaceutical Intermediate: A critical precursor in the semi-synthesis of complex anticancer agents and other therapeutic vinca alkaloids.
  • Research & Development: Used in biochemical and pharmacological research to study structure-activity relationships (SAR) of vinca alkaloid derivatives.
  • Reference Standard: Serves as a high-purity analytical standard for quality control and method development in pharmaceutical analysis.
  • Academic Studies: Employed in university and institutional research for exploring novel synthetic pathways and natural product modifications.
  • Process Chemistry: Utilized in scaling up and optimizing synthetic routes for the production of advanced pharmaceutical ingredients (APIs).

Basic Information

Product Name 4-o-Deacetylvinblastine-3-Oic Acid
CAS No. 60223-75-8
Molecular Formula C44H54N4O9
Molecular Weight 782.93 g/mol
Synonyms 4-O-Deacetylvinblastine-3-carboxylic Acid; 3-Carboxyvinblastine; Deacetylvinblastine Acid; 4-Desacetylvinblastine-3-carboxylic Acid; NSC 682245; Vinblastine-3-carboxylic Acid; 4-O-Deacetylvinblastine Acid; 4-Desacetylvinblastine Ac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This product is hygroscopic (moisture-sensitive) and light-sensitive; therefore, containers must be kept sealed in a dry environment and opened under conditions of low humidity to prevent degradation.
